What is Cassandra “Elvira” Peterson’s Net Worth?

Cassandra “Elvira” Peterson is a multi-talented TV personality with a net worth of $3 million. She gained fame as the gothic goddess Elvira, Mistress of the Dark on KHJ’s weekly show “Elvira’s Movie Macabre,” which aired from 1981 to 1986 and returned in 2010.

Prior to her Elvira days, Peterson worked as a showgirl and had small roles in films like “The Working Girls” and “Diamonds are Forever.” She was also the lead singer of an Italian rock band and performed with comedy acts Mamma’s Boys and The Groundings.

Peterson has over 80 acting credits to her name, including roles in “Pee-wee’s Big Adventure,” “Red Riding Hood,” and “All About Evil.” She has also worked as a writer and producer on several Elvira-related projects, including “Elvira’s Movie Macabre,” “The Elvira Show,” and “13 Nights of Elvira.”

In 2016, Peterson published a “coffin table” book called “Elvira, Mistress of The Dark: A Photographic Retrospective of the Queen of Halloween.”

Cassandra Peterson’s Early Life

Cassandra Peterson was born in Manhattan, Kansas, in 1951. She suffered severe burns as a child, which made her feel like an outcast and a loner. Peterson grew up in Colorado Springs and saw her first horror movie in elementary school. She graduated from Palmer High School in 1969 and worked as a go-go dancer at a gay bar as a teenager.

Cassandra “Elvira” Peterson’s Career Highlights

Cassandra Peterson started her career as the youngest showgirl in Las Vegas at age 17. She later became a lead vocalist for various bands and joined the improv troupe The Groundlings. In 1981, she began hosting “Elvira’s Movie Macabre” and created the iconic Elvira persona with her best friend, Robert Redding. She has since appeared as Elvira in numerous projects, including movies, TV shows, and as a guest judge on “Halloween Wars.”

Aside from her Elvira persona, Peterson has also appeared in various films such as “Diamonds are Forever,” “Pee-wee’s Big Adventure,” and “Allan Quatermain and the Lost City of Gold.” She has lent her voice to animated films and TV series such as “The Haunted World of El Superbeasto” and “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les.”

Peterson has also released several albums, such as “Elvira Presents Vinyl Macabre: Oldies but Ghoulies” and “Elvira’s Gravest Hits.” In 2021, she appeared in the film “Shoplifters of the World” and voiced Lirrak on the Netflix series “Dota: Dragon’s Blood.”

Cassandra Peterson’s Personal Life

Cassandra married Mark Pierson in 1981 and they had a daughter named Sadie in 1994. Pierson became her manager after their marriage and the couple divorced in 2003.

In a 2014 interview, Cassandra spoke about meeting Elvis Presley and going on a date with him. She credited Presley with giving her career advice that changed her life, saying, “He is 100 percent responsible for me getting out of Vegas and going on with my career. Elvis said to me, ‘You don’t want to stay here, this is not a town you should be in.’ And I don’t think if that would’ve come from anybody but Elvis I would’ve done it.”

Accolades and Awards

Cassandra “Elvira” Peterson has received numerous awards and accolades throughout her career. In 2018, she was honored with a Lifetime Achievement Award at Hollywood Horrorfest, and she was inducted into the Horror Host Hall Of Fame in 2012. Peterson won the Rondo Hatton Classic Horror Award for Favorite Horror Host in 2011 and was inducted into the Monster Kid Hall of Fame in 2017. She also received the Spirit of Silver Lake Award at the 2001 Los Angeles Silver Lake Film Festival and was nominated for a Best Actress Saturn Award by the Academy of Science Fiction, Fantasy & Horror Films for her role in “Elvira: Mistress of the Dark” in 1990.

Brad Pitt’s Haunted Los Feliz Estate

In 1994, Brad Pitt purchased a 5,338 square foot property in LA’s Los Feliz neighborhood from Cassandra for $1.7 million. He later acquired neighboring properties to create a 2-acre multi-structure compound. In January 2023, Brad reportedly listed the estate home off-market for $40 million.

Cassandra believed the property was haunted, experiencing strange occurrences such as footsteps above her head on the ceiling, smoke forming into human shapes, and a black shadow floating on the bottom of the pool. After a priest performed an exorcism and a Native American cleansed the home with sage, the disturbances reportedly stopped.
